The land of Israel was made up out of twelve tribes. Theese tribes would squabble over petty things, and war was a common thing. However theese wars were quick and led to nothing more then a few hundred dead Israelites. But in one of theese tribes, the tribe of Judah, an orphan was made when the chieftain Jonathan was slayed on the battlefield. The orphans name was David. David was only 7 years old when his father was killed, and thus his throne was passed on to Jonathans brother Benjamin. Benjamin, a wise old man, sent young David to a military academy. The worlds first military academy as a matter of facts. He lived amongst the soldiers, and by the young age of 12, he was respected as a warrior. When David was nearing the age of 16, his once so friendly uncle decided to send young David to war, so he would remain king for a while longer. This was the decline of the tribe of Juda, and the birth of Israel. Judah went to war with the tribes of Dan and Benjamin. But it wouldn't take long before all twelve tribes got involved. At first, most tribes allied against Judah, but when word of young Davids military prowess started to spread few continued to fight, some became neutral and many allied with Judah. It seemd as if Benjamins plan to have David kille in battle had failed. When David returned to the fair city of Jerusalem he was celebrated by the citizens as a great conqueror, and the father of the Nation of Israel. Benjamin saw no other option but to abdicate, and thus young David was now King David and 19 years old.

David, being a military man, sent his troops east to claim land for Israel and to investigate the rumors of a distand tribe in the fertile lands of the Euphraties and the Tigris. If this tribe would turn out to be friendly or not, David did not know. David himself would stay in Israel and rebuild the lands after the long war. Some would say he was a coward for doing that. Then again, some would be hung for saying that.
